Output c0bba81ab159add8e6c9c4aecba82a5368455ade0937d2c052a2807c0fadb773:98

value
27015
script pubkey
OP_0 OP_PUSHBYTES_32 cc3a5e1c02b12fc245c91204024257b943726580f31580a1c31b3d5ea9c7bb07
address
bc1qesa9u8qzkyhuy3wfzgzqysjhh9phyevq7v2cpgwrrv74a2w8hvrsj0p3r0
transaction
c0bba81ab159add8e6c9c4aecba82a5368455ade0937d2c052a2807c0fadb773
confirmations
51771
spent
true